Schedule a thorough inspection of your fence every few months, especially after storms or hot summers. Check for loose nails, broken boards, rust spots, or signs of decay. Cleaning your fence removes dirt, mildew, and pollutants that accelerate wear. Use mild soap and water or specialized fencing cleaners depending on your fence material.

Texas windstorms can loosen fence components. Check for wobbly posts or sagging panels and have them reinforced or replaced early to avoid costly repairs.

Fence replacement cost depends on fence type, total length, and labor. Wood fence replacement cost is usually lower than vinyl or metal fence replacement.
Fence installation cost in TX varies based on material, fence height, and property size. Wood and chain link fences are typically more affordable than vinyl or custom fencing.
